Web11 sep. 2024 · Irish homelessness figures have reached a new high, with over 10,400 people in July 2024 registered as homeless. Figures released by the Department of Housing, Heritage and Local Government have revealed that the amount of people in emergency homeless accommodation has risen again, for the sixth month in a row.
